問題タブ [getpasswd]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
3 に答える
127 参照

python - ランダムに生成されたパスワードの生成と入力の要求

私のプログラムは、ユーザー入力がそれに一致する必要があるように、変数に割り当てられた特定の事前定義されたパスワードを記憶する必要があります。

コードでパスワードを受け取り、それを入力する必要があります。無関係なコーディングの大部分を削除したので、主なことは、ユーザーがパスワードを取得し、後でそれを入力する必要があることです。したがって、パスワードはランダムな文字のセットであり、ユーザーが覚えて必要なときに入力する必要があるパスワードです。

それは機能していません。誰かが助けてくれるかどうか疑問に思っていました。

GetPassWarningまた、輸入によりシェルに出る赤い文字( )を消す方法はありgetpass.getpass()ますか?

ありがとう。

0 投票する
1 に答える
542 参照

python - getpass() 最後に改行を追加 (Eclipse)

Eclipse で次のコードを実行すると、getPass は末尾にキャリッジが付加された文字列を返します。

ただし、コマンドプロンプトで同じコードを実行すると、問題なく実行されます。

出力 (Eclipse):

出力 (コマンド プロンプト):

誰もこの曖昧さを説明できますか?

ありがとう!!

0 投票する
1 に答える
181 参照

python - python getpass モジュールがドイツ語の文字を入力として取りません

Windows 7 で python getpassモジュールを使用してドイツ語の文字を含むパスワードを入力しようとしています。Pythonのバージョンは 2.7.8 です。

  • まず、システム ロケールをドイツ語 (ドイツ) に設定し、再起動します。
  • コマンド プロンプトのコードページが、ドイツ語の文字をサポートする cp850 に設定されるようになりました。
  • 次に、次のようにコマンド プロンプトで getpass を実行します。

    pwd = getpass.getpass()

    印刷パスワード

  • パスワードとしてöを入力しましたが、印刷しても何も得られません。これは、0 であるパスワードの長さを出力することによって確認されます。

対応するロケールを設定すると、同じことが中国語、日本語、韓国語の文字で機能します。

Python 2.3.5でも同じことがあり、同じ問題が続きます。

何か間違ったことをしている場合はお知らせください。

0 投票する
0 に答える
833 参照

python - Python で POP (poplib) を使用して Gmail にログインできないのはなぜですか?

POP で Gmail にログインしようとしています。Gmail のプライバシー設定で POP/IMAP と「安全性の低いアプリへのアクセス」を有効にしました。私はいつも同じエラーが発生します。

何が間違っているのかわかりません。これは私のソースコードです。